The good is that which is in accord with objective reality.
An insight into the nature of the good makes certain attitudes impossible.
It makes impossible the attitude of always referring to oneself and to the judgment of one’s conscience.
The man who wishes to realize the good does not look upon his own act, but upon the truth of real objects.
Objectivity, if thereby we mean fidelity to being, is the proper attitude of man.
Josef Pieper, Reality and the Good
